Tell me more about the turbo kit on the bike. I've had thoughts of going that route on mine sometime...


K.
 
It's not a kit , I built it all at my shop, It all started with a Garrett turbo i bought from a friend (off of his ninja) I had it rebuilt and went from there. I basically built the bike around the turbo.I mounted the turbo and went to town, I didn't like how the kits looked, they hung off the side of the bike and looked like they were just stuck on the bike. I took me over a year to build, it took me two weeks just to figure out and build the header.
